2. Safety Information

  • Do not expose this equipment to rain or moisture.
  • Do not remove the cover or back panel. There are no user-serviceable parts inside. Refer all servicing to qualified service personnel.
  • Ensure proper ventilation to prevent overheating.
  • Use only the power adapter supplied with the unit.
  • Avoid placing the mixer near heat sources or in direct sunlight.
  • Disconnect power before cleaning or when not in use for extended periods.

5. Component Identification

Familiarize yourself with the various controls and connections on your mixer:

  • MIC/LINE Inputs (Channels 1-5): XLR/TRS combo jacks for microphones or line-level instruments.
  • INSERT Jacks (Channels 1-5): For connecting external effects processors to individual channels.
  • GAIN Knobs: Adjust input sensitivity for each channel.
  • HIGH/MID/LOW EQ Knobs: 3-band equalizer for tone control on each channel.
  • EFFECT Knobs: Adjust the amount of effect sent to each channel.
  • PAN Knobs: Adjust the stereo position of each channel.
  • LEVEL Faders: Control the volume of each channel.
  • TAPE OUT (L/R): RCA outputs for recording.
  • MAIN OUT (L/R): TRS outputs for main stereo mix.
  • AUX OUT: Auxiliary output.
  • PHONE Jack: 6.35mm headphone output for monitoring.
  • USB Interface: For connecting USB drives for playback or connecting to a computer.
  • MP3 Playback Controls: Play/Pause, Skip, Mode selection for USB/Bluetooth.
  • +48V PHANTOM Power Switch: Activates phantom power for condenser microphones.
  • LEVEL Meter: LED indicators for output level.
  • DELAY/REPEAT Knobs: Control parameters for the built-in effects.
  • MAIN Fader: Controls the overall output volume.
  • POWER DC-IN: Power input for the supplied adapter.

6. Setup

Follow these steps to set up your audio mixer:

  1. Unpacking: Carefully remove the mixer and all accessories from the packaging.
  2. Placement: Place the mixer on a stable, flat surface away from direct sunlight, heat sources, and moisture.
  3. Power Connection: Ensure the mixer's power switch is in the OFF position. Connect the supplied power adapter to the "POWER DC-IN" port on the mixer and then plug the adapter into a suitable power outlet.
  4. Initial Checks: Before powering on, ensure all faders are at their lowest setting and all gain knobs are turned down.

7. Operating Instructions

7.1 Connecting Audio Sources

The mixer supports a wide range of input devices:

  • Microphones: Connect dynamic or condenser microphones to the MIC/LINE inputs using XLR cables. Activate +48V Phantom Power for condenser microphones.
  • Instruments: Connect instruments like guitars or keyboards to the MIC/LINE inputs using 1/4" TRS cables.
  • Line-Level Devices: Connect CD players, media players, or other line-level devices to the MIC/LINE inputs.
  • USB Playback: Insert a USB flash drive into the USB interface for direct audio file playback. Use the MP3 playback controls to navigate tracks.

7.2 Bluetooth Connection

To connect a Bluetooth device:

  1. Power on the mixer.
  2. Press the "MODE" button on the MP3 playback control section until "BLUE" appears on the display.
  3. On your Bluetooth-enabled device (e.g., smartphone, tablet, laptop), search for available Bluetooth devices.
  4. Select "jindaaudio E7USB" (or similar name) from the list to pair.
  5. Once paired, you can play audio from your device through the mixer. Use the mixer's playback controls or your device's controls.

7.3 Adjusting Sound

Use the following controls to shape your sound:

  • GAIN: Adjust for optimal input level without clipping. The PEAK LED will light up if the signal is too hot.
  • EQ (HIGH, MID, LOW): Fine-tune the treble, midrange, and bass frequencies for each channel.
  • EFFECT: Send a portion of the channel's signal to the built-in effects processor.
  • PAN: Position the sound of each channel in the stereo field (left to right).
  • LEVEL Faders: Control the individual volume of each channel.
  • MAIN Fader: Control the overall output volume of the mixed signal. Monitor the LEVEL meter to avoid clipping.

7.4 Using Effects (FX)

The mixer includes a reverb/delay effect:

  • Use the individual channel's EFFECT knob to send signal to the effects processor.
  • Adjust the DELAY and REPEAT knobs in the master effects section to control the characteristics of the effect.
  • The EFF fader controls the overall volume of the applied effect.

8. Maintenance

To ensure the longevity and optimal performance of your mixer:

  • Cleaning: Use a soft, dry cloth to clean the exterior. For stubborn dirt, a slightly damp cloth can be used, but ensure no liquid enters the unit. Do not use abrasive cleaners or solvents.
  • Dust Control: Keep the mixer free from dust. Consider using a dust cover when not in use.
  • Storage: Store the mixer in a cool, dry place when not in use for extended periods.
  • Cable Management: Avoid bending or crimping cables excessively.

9. Troubleshooting

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
No sound output
  • Power not connected or turned on.
  • Main fader or channel fader too low.
  • Incorrect input/output connections.
  • Speakers/headphones not connected or turned on.
  • Check power connection and switch.
  • Increase main and channel fader levels.
  • Verify all cables are correctly connected to inputs/outputs.
  • Ensure monitoring devices are properly connected and powered.
Distorted sound
  • Input gain too high (clipping).
  • Output level too high.
  • Faulty cable or connection.
  • Reduce input GAIN until PEAK LED no longer lights up.
  • Lower MAIN fader.
  • Try different cables.
Microphone not working
  • +48V Phantom Power not enabled (for condenser mics).
  • Microphone not connected properly.
  • Channel gain too low.
  • Activate +48V Phantom Power switch.
  • Ensure microphone is securely connected to the XLR input.
  • Increase channel GAIN.
Bluetooth not connecting
  • Mixer not in Bluetooth mode.
  • Device too far from mixer.
  • Interference.
  • Press MODE button until "BLUE" is displayed.
  • Move device closer to the mixer.
  • Turn off other Bluetooth devices nearby.
